Selecting the Best Material Type
Regarding car wrapping, picking the right material is essential for getting a spectacular finish and guaranteeing long-lasting quality. There are different types of vinyl wraps available on the market, which are each designed for specific applications. For instance, high-quality vinyl is known for its remarkable flexibility and enduring performance, making it a top choice for detailed designs and curves. On the other hand, budget vinyl, while more economical, may not offer the same level of stretchability and is often best suited for flat surfaces.
One more important factor is the finish of the wrap. Car wraps are available in various finishes including gloss, matte, silk, and patterned options. Gloss finishes provide a bright look that echoes a fresh paint job, while flat finishes give a sleek appearance. Textured wraps, such as carbon fiber or brushed metal, can offer your vehicle a special touch. The selection of finish will significantly impact the overall appearance of your car wrap in areas like Oahu and Honolulu.
Finally, the durability of the material must be taken into account. High-quality wraps usually last between five to seven years when adequately maintained. Investing in top-quality material can protect you time and money in the long run, making sure that your vehicle keeps its look and defense from the elements. Maintenance and Care Tips
To guarantee your car wrap remains bright and endures for years, regular maintenance is essential. Start by cleaning your wrapped vehicle with a gentle soap and fresh water. Steer clear of automated car washes with brushes, as they may harm the wrap. Rather, opt for hand washing using gentle microfiber cloths to protect the surface from scratches while retaining the wrap’s appearance.
Additionally, it is crucial to keep your vehicle out of extended exposure to harsh conditions. If possible, park your car in a garage or cover it with a covering when not in use. When parked outside, try to prevent direct sunlight for extended periods, as UV rays can fade the colors and weaken the adhesive. A protective sealant specifically designed for wraps can also provide an extra level of protection from environmental damage.
Lastly, inspect your wrap regularly for any signs of wear or damage. Addressing issues like lifting edges or small tears quickly can stop further deterioration.
